Total body-catcher, doesn't run block, goes down at first contact......you like him because he's big and fast....so is Chaz Schilens.

Unlike you I don't care how big or fast a WR is, NFL draft history is filled with the remains of big fast and tall WR's that were utter busts at the next level.


I look at their overall skills as a WR, abilities, the quality of their hands, route-running, how they catch the ball..etc. Hunter is tall but lanky, fast but a sloppy route runner, cheats by using his body to make plays, in the NFL that simply won't work.

He could do well in the NFL, but he's got a lot of work to do on the fundamentals of being a receiver, his athleticism, just like for many other college studs, won't be enough by itself to carry him in the NFL. He needs to add weight, he needs to utilize his hands to snatch the ball, not allow passes to get into his body, he needs to work on his concentration, not drop so many passes, improve his route-running...etc.....he's a work in progress, just as Patterson is.
